What is the Florida Financial Interest Statement Form 1?
The Florida Financial Interest Statement Form 1 is a vital document used in the state of Florida for financial disclosure by public officials. This form requires comprehensive details regarding an individual's financial interests, which include sources of income, real estate holdings, and any business interests. It is mandatory for individuals to sign and file this form within 30 days following their employment or appointment to ensure compliance with state regulations.
The required information encompasses various aspects such as income, real property, and business investments. This level of disclosure promotes transparency and accountability within state governance, reflecting the importance of ethical public service.

Who Needs to Complete the Florida Financial Interest Statement Form 1?
This form is required from specific roles within local and state government. Individuals who are elected officials, appointed members, and certain state employees must complete the Florida Financial Interest Statement Form 1 to disclose their financial interests.
Filing obligations arise under particular circumstances, such as when starting a new role or during annual reporting periods. Understanding the eligibility criteria is vital to ensure that all necessary personnel fulfill their required disclosures in a timely manner.

Who is required to complete the Florida Financial Interest Statement Form 1?
Local officers, employees, and specified state employees in Florida are required to complete this form to disclose their financial interests and meet ethical obligations.
What is the deadline for submitting this form?
The form must be filed with the appropriate authority within 30 days of your appointment or the beginning of your employment to comply with reporting requirements.
How should I submit the completed Florida Financial Interest Statement Form 1?
You can submit the completed form by mailing it to the relevant ethics office or electronically through the official portal, depending on local guidelines.
Do I need to submit any supporting documents with this form?
Typically, you do not need to submit additional documents with the form. However, be prepared to provide documents if requested for verification of disclosed interests.

Is notarization required for this form?
No, notarization is not required for the Florida Financial Interest Statement Form 1, but you must provide a valid signature as it's essential for authenticity.
